How Packet Handling Affects VPN Speed and Reliability

Learn how packet handling impacts VPN speed and reliability through MTU optimization, routing efficiency, and reduced latency.

When people use a VPN, they usually think about things like speed or which server they’re connected to.

But what most people don’t realize is that the real magic happens much deeper—in how the VPN handles tiny pieces of data called packets.

Every time you open a website, watch a video, or send a message, your data is broken into these small packets. A VPN has to handle thousands of them every second.

And honestly, how well it handles those packets can make or break your experience.


What’s Actually Happing Behind the Scenes

It’s pretty simple in idea, but complex in action.

Each packet:

  • gets encrypted
  • travels through a secure tunnel
  • then gets decrypted on the other side

And this is happening constantly, in milliseconds.

If this process is smooth, everything feels fast and stable.
If it’s not—you start noticing delays, buffering, or random drops.

Getting Packet Size Just Right

There’s a small but important detail here—packet size.

If packets are too big:

  • they get split into smaller parts
  • which slows things down

If they’re too small:

  • there are too many of them
  • which adds extra work

So the goal is balance. When it’s tuned properly, everything runs much more smoothly.

What Happens When Packets Get Lost

Sometimes packets don’t reach their destination.

This can happen because:

  • the network is weak
  • the signal drops
  • or the server is overloaded

When that happens, they have to be sent again.

Too much of this leads to:

  • lag
  • buffering
  • unstable connections

A good VPN handles this quietly in the background so you don’t notice.
